Horizon has recently sponsored the first yacht exhibition area at the National Museum of Marine Science and Technology in Taiwan. The company is presently designing and building an exhibit that showcases Horizon’s detailed yacht design and construction processes, including a display of the Horizon E84 yacht main deck interior.

The brand-new Hornet yacht tender by Couach is set to make its worldwide premiere at the next Cannes International Boat Show in September. Designed by the yard’s in-house team and Franck Reynaud, it can reach an impressive top speed of 52 knots.
